The Mirafi BXG-series is a biaxial geogrid built to reinforce aggregate bases and stabilize soft subgrade.
Made from punched-and-drawn polypropylene, these rigid geogrids confine aggregate through their apertures, spreading loads and reducing rutting over weak soils. They are used under roads, parking lots, and working platforms for base course reinforcement.
The BXG-series lets designers reduce aggregate thickness and extend service life, providing all-directional stiffness that keeps the base intact under repeated traffic loading.
Our BABA Compliant Roadbase Geogrid is a biaxial geogrid used for base course reinforcement and soil stabilization applications. These geogrids provide high strength at low strain and are designed for maximum bearing capacity and shear resistance. This product has the ability of a geosynthetic to restrain lateral movement from a soil or aggregate through friction or mechanical interlock.

Manufactured in the USA — BABA & Berry Compliant
Produced in Georgia, USA — qualifying for Build America / Buy America and Berry Amendment requirements on federal, state, and municipal infrastructure projects.
